Consideration of the control interface is vital. Some boxes offer a digital display, providing real-time data monitoring. This feature can enhance decision-making during high-pressure scenarios. Alternatively, basic models rely on analog gauges. While these may be reliable, they may lack detailed information when you need it most. Users should reflect on their experience and preferences to determine what suits them best.
Another aspect to ponder is maintenance. Some well control boxes require regular calibration and servicing. This can lead to operational downtime if not managed effectively. In contrast, other models may be more robust, needing less frequent attention. Balancing reliability and maintenance needs can be challenging, but it's key to ensuring your operations remain smooth. Tips for Proper Maintenance and Safety of Well Control Boxes
When it comes to well control boxes, proper maintenance and safety are essential. A well-maintained box ensures equipment reliability and personnel safety in critical operations. Regular inspections are crucial. Check for any signs of wear, corrosion, or damage. These could lead to failures during operations.
One tip is to always keep your well control box clean. Dirt and grime can affect its performance. Use appropriate cleaning agents and avoid abrasive materials. Inspect the electrical connections as well. Loose connections can result in malfunctions. Ensure that all seals are intact to prevent leaks.
Additionally, understanding the manufacturer's guidelines is vital. Follow recommended maintenance schedules rigorously. Document all maintenance actions taken. This creates a reliable history and can aid in troubleshooting issues. Training personnel on how to operate and maintain the box is equally important. Misunderstanding can lead to accidents, impacting safety and efficiency. Always prioritize safe practices in every operation.
